So let me guess...You just spent that saved up money on a super-cool new head-unit.
Finally, you have that first simple mod to begin spicing up the interior and get rid of that ugly, crappy stock head-unit that has absolutely NO functionality.
Well congrats. I'm proud of you, welcome to the wonderful world of Car-Audio.
But oh no. What's happening?
-Your Speedometer doesn't work unless the radio is powered off.
-Your Odometer isn't gaining mileage (not even the computer is logging mileage...shhh....)
-And your Gas Range computer is going up and down like your filling your tank.
So what the h*ll is happening? Is your Tib broken? How can you fix this?Is it permanent?
Now, it doesn't matter whether or not YOU installed it; a buddy installed it; or even if a professional Install shop installed it (and yes, even Best-buy doesn't catch this error). This is a common error throughout the Tiburon community but its rare that an Install-Shop will know about it.
You need to CUT the Blue Amp-Remote wire. yes, the Blue wire labeled Amp-Remote. Usually it carries a White stripe down it.
Cut it and cap it off. Simple as that.
There will be NO permanent damage, it's just a grounding issue. Once you cut it, all will be good again. Just cap it off properly and enjoy.
Yes, i promise, That will fix your problem. You can do it or you can bring it to the Audio-Shop you had install your Radio and make them do it for free. Then educate the stupid out of them.
So, what went wrong?
Now, this seems to happen in ALL Tibs 03-08. Even the SUPER-RARE 2009 models sold on Craigslist. (haha)
BUT, it only happens in Tiburon's WITHOUT the Stock Infinity Audio System.
The problem is the After-Market wiring Harness you used. Yes. The Wiring harness.
This thing:
Now it doesn't matter what brand it is : Metra, Scosche, Bestbuy or Walmart. Any and every brand seems to do it.
Well, what is wrong with the harness?
It's that Blue Amp-Remote Wire: This is the wire that comes FROM the Headunit that carries a 12v signal to an Amplifier in the Car. Either for Subs or speakers (or both). This is hooked up to the Audio system to tell the Amps that the head-unit is on. Nothing more, Nothing less. Its a basic wire.
Now, if you have the Stock Infinity system, this wire is hooked up normally. It tells the Stock Amp to turn on...And work. Simple.
But if you DO NOT have the Stock amp, this wire is still grounded to the Car. And that is where the problem is. When the Radio turns on and sends the 12v Signal through the wire...It has nothing to power. So it grounds out onto the Car. And oddly enough, it shares the SAME grounding point as the Speed Sensor and fuel gauge.
So, this results in your Speedo stopping, Odometer taking a cr*p and your fuel gauge freaking out.
Simple, huh? Makes sense now, right? Well time to go fix it!
